ZF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2019 in Review

35 of the 4,625 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Virtus Total Return Fund Inc. (ZF) for Q2 2019, worth a combined $30.8M — up 12% from $27.5M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 5 funds closed out of ZF and 4 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 13 trimmed existing stakes and 9 added.

The largest buyer was Advisors Asset Management, adding an estimated $1.01M. The largest seller was Rivernorth Capital Management, cutting an estimated $3.64M.
